I have recently returned from my first trip to PDC and loved every minute. I did not want to get on the plane to come home. went with some of my girly friends and got to chill in the sun for 2 weeks. sat by the pool most of the time and should have gone to the beach more for a better tan. visited the teguise market which was good (not great with a hangover tho! haha) and really needed longer there as didnt get to look at everything, although there are lots of stalls selling very similar things, almost felt like couldnt haggle with some of the stalls ( but this is prob because havent really done it before!) we visited centro atlantico probably every other night and yes you may get hassled by the pr, but we took full advantage of all the freebies on offer. we got to know quite a few of the pr and bar managers and they really looked after us, it was one of the girls birthdays and on the monday it was ladies night at tequila bar, we said we would go there and they got the birthday girl a cake and made a real fuss over us. Yes i may of been a victim of the old holiday romance but all i can say is i had a wicked time, and would definatly go back.
